How to make it
- Preheat oven to 300°F.
- In a medium bowl combine flour, baking powder, cinnamon and nutmeg.
- Blend well with a whisk and set aside.
- In a large bowl cream sugar and butter with an electric mixer.
- Add eggnog, vanilla and egg yolks and beat at medium speed until smooth.
- Add the flour mixture and beat at low speed just until blended.
- Do not over mix.
- Drop by rounded teaspoons onto an ungreased baking sheet, 1 inch apart.
- Sprinkle lightly with a mixture of sugar and ground cinnamon..
- Bake for 23 minutes or until bottoms turn a light brown.
- Transfer to a wire rack to cool.
